Additive Effects in Living Cationic Polymerization of tort-Butyl Vinyl Ether, initiated by Iodine

  • Living nature was appeared in the cationic polymerization of tort-butyl vinyl ether (TBVE), initiated by iodine, carried out in toluene at -78$^{\circ}C$. It was found that the number average molar mass of the resulting polymer (equation omitted) increases linearly as the conversion to polymer increase which reveals that there is no operation of chain transfer or termination process in this system. The polymers having narrow distribution and having molar mass of the resulting polymers are dependent on molar ratio of monomer and iodine.

Ferroelectric P(VDF/TrFE) Copolymers in Low-Cost Non-Volatile Data Storage Applications

  • P(VDF/TrFE(72/28) ultrathin films were used in the fabrication of Metal-Ferroelectric polymer-Metal (MFM) single bit device with special emphasis on uniform film surface, faster dipole switching time under applied external field and longer memory retention time. AFM and FTIR-GIRAS were complementary in analyzing surface crystalline morphology and the resultant change in chain orientation with varying thermal history. DC-EFM technique was used to 'write-read-erase' the data on the memory bit in a much faster time than P-E studies. The results obtained from this study will enable us to have a good understanding of the ferroelectric and piezoelectric behavior of P(VDF/TrFE)(72/28) thin films suitable for high density data storage applications.

A STUDY ON THE LYOTROPIC LIQUID CRYSTALLINE COPOLYAMIDE

  • To improve the fibrillation phenomenon and processibili to of poly(p-phenyleneterephthalamide) (PPD-T) , a P/E copolyamide was prepared by introducing 4,4'-ethylene dianiline (EDA) into rigid chain backbone. The effects of semi-flexible segment on the liquid crystalline properties were investigated. The EDA, used as a comonomer, was prepared by catalylitic reduction of p,p'-dinitrophenyl , obtained by oxidative coupling of p,p'-dinitrotoluene. Various high molecular weight PIE copolyamides were prepared by low temperature solution polycondensation of terephthaloyl chloride (TPC) with various mixtures of p-phenylene diamine (PPD) and EOA. The PfE copolyamides were completely dissolved in 100% svlfuric acid, and the phase transition of P/E copolyamide-sulfuric acid systems was examined in teams of concentration and temperature. Over the chemical compositions, PIE=911, 812, and 713, solutions of anisotropic single phase were acquired. In particular, the two mixing ratios, 911 and 812, gave a good anisotropic spinning dope.

Effects of Heat Treatment on Electrical and Mechanical Properties of Glass Fiber Reinforced Epoxy (열처리가 유리섬유 강화 복합재료의 전기적 및 기계적 성질에 미치는 영향)

  • In this work, the properties of FRP, which is applied recently in the composite insulating materials, by thermal treatment were investigated. The specimens were epoxy glass laminates fabricated by thermal press method and had the volume content of 46[%] cutted $45^{\circ}C$ in the fiber direction and 1.0[mm] thickness. The experimental results showed that the amount of weight loss, wettability, surface potential, and surface resistivity increased up to 200[$^{\circ}C$] as a function of temperature. Usually, most degradations caused the hydrophilic to decrease the contact angle. But, in this work on thermal-degradated FRP, we can confirm the introduction of hydrophobic properties by cross-linking and the ablation of polar small-molecules rather than chain scission and oxidation. Finally, weight loss and contact angle increased. These phenomena show the existence of hydrophobic surface. With the change to the hydrophobic surface and the electrical potential and resistivity on FRP surface increased. But, the dielectric properties and tensile stength are decreased.

The Empirical Research on Underwear Products Strategies According to Consumer's Purchasing Characteristics of Sex (소비자의 성별 구매특성에 따른 내의류 제품전략에 대한 실증연구)

  • The purpose of this study was to compare the characteristics of underwear consumer's underwear purchasing behavior through survey. 630 questionnaires were distributed in Seoul and Chonju and 618 with usable data were analyzed frequency and factor analyses, t-test etc. using SPSSWIN 10.0. program. The results were summarized as follows : Most male consumers buy underwears at discount stores whereas most female consumers at chain store. Throughout all four seasons, more male and female consumers do not wear heat-retaining underwears. Most male and female consumers do not have function-fiber underwears nor functional-finishing and natural-dyeing-treated underwears. Most consumers are not satisfied with these underwears. The most important criteria for most male consumers to choose underwears are comfort levels while in action, the sense of touch, comfort levels while wearing them while not in action, pleasance levels; whereas for females are comfort levels while in action, and comfort levels while wearing them while not in action. Male consumers prefer a little bigger-than-their-bodies size, dry and soft fabrics, plain white color; whereas female consumers prefer a little tight size, dry and soft fabrics and plain beige color, Most consumers want to buy functional-fiber underwears made of yellow- soil-and-charcoal-dyeing fabrics which has jade.
